Every car has a license plate number, which begins with a letter S, followed by two other letters, 4 digits, and another letter (all upper case) How many possible license plate numbers are there? Is the answer the following? 26^2 * 10^4 * 26 = 175760000 There is a part 2! It turns out that all plate numbers beginning with SH are for taxis only. How many possible license plate numbers for private car owners? My answer: Taxis: 26 *10^4 *26 = 6760000 So Private Car Owners: 175760000 - 6760000 = 169000000

oh wait no it's not
it say followed by OTHER two letters,
so since S is already chosen, you have 25 lefts
Couldn't S be used for the other areas too?
well, this is more like a language issue. If S is allowed to be picked again, you had the correct answer. If not, then just 25^2 * 10^4 * 25.

Should be correct I guess @sourwing
yes, it's correct. Again, assuming S is allowed to be chosen again. Another way, to do this problem is 25 * 26 * 10^4 * 26 = 169,000,000 As long as the third digit is not H, which you have only 25 to choose from
i mean third *letter*
